Israeli AI researchers offered $15K-$27K monthly salaries as firms scramble for rare model-building talent

ziv_ravid · x · 2026-09-19

Israeli tech media reports that AI researchers who can actually build new models are being offered roughly 50K-90K shekels gross per month, before equity and perks. The piece notes software engineers are plentiful, but people who truly know how to develop and research new models are extremely rare — the resource every big company and startup, including Ilya Sutskever's SSI and Amnon Shashua's AI firm, is competing for in Israel. The AI race talks about GPUs, data centers and power, but the scarcest resource is the people who can build the models themselves.
